Ottawa police have taken five individuals into custody on drug-related charges following a significant operation in the city's Westboro neighbourhood. The arrests stemmed from a traffic stop where the involved vehicle reportedly attempted to evade officers.
Vehicle Attempts to Flee During Police Stop
The incident unfolded on January 6, 2025, when officers initiated a routine traffic stop in the Westboro area. According to police statements, the driver of the vehicle did not comply and instead tried to flee the scene. This attempt to escape prompted a swift response from law enforcement, leading to the vehicle being successfully stopped and the occupants detained.
Large-Scale Police Operation Leads to Multiple Arrests
The traffic stop was part of a larger, coordinated police effort in the community. Following the initial intervention, authorities conducted a thorough investigation linked to the vehicle and its occupants. This resulted in the arrest of five men, all of whom now face charges connected to drug offences. Police have not released the specific types or quantities of drugs allegedly involved at this time.
